Default Dash lights and headlights question

I have an '07 1LT and, for some odd reason, have never driven it at night. When I did tonight I could not figure out how to get the headlights and dash lights to stay on at the same time. If I turn the dash lights on, the screen says "headlights suggested." But when I turn them on the dash lights go off. If I have headlights on and turn on the dash lights the headlights go off.

I looked in the the owners's manual and searched it but not much success. I sure hope this is my dumbness rather than some other problem. I am sort-of embarrassed to even post this.
Please tell me this is just me and not a real problem.

The dash lights are on all the time when the engine is running. They're just brighter during the day, or when you turn the headlights off. However, you can brighten them a little with the dash light dimmer switch at your left knee.

But, as I've indicated, nighttime dash lights will never be as bright as the daytime dash lights.

It sounds like you need to adjust the dimming level on your dash lights. What I suspect is happening is your dim level on the dash is turned down. By default, when you turn on the headlights the dash lights will dim slightly and it makes the gauge cluster appear to turn off the dash lights. That level can be adjusted by the **** to to the left of the steering wheel. Turn it to the right to increase the brightness level of the dashlights with your headlights on.

The dashlights adjust automatically with the use of the headlights. You don't actually turn on the dashlights with the switch on the stalk. That turns the headlights on and off and in your case it is making it appear (when the headlights go off) that the dash is getting brighter.
